What Actually Matters When Choosing the Best eSIM for Japan

To find a reliable connection for your trip, you must look past basic data limits and evaluate the underlying technical performance that keeps your phone functional on the move.

Ground Coverage

Multi-network access is essential across Japan's varied terrain. Relying on one carrier leaves you without service in deep subways or remote mountains. Switching between Docomo, SoftBank, and KDDI ensures a continuous, strong connection.

Real-World Speeds

Consistent throughput for navigation matters more than peak speeds. Usable speed means instantly loading complex Google Maps routes or translation scans in crowded stations, regardless of daily network congestion or the time of day.

Networks & Reliability

A reliable connection maintains stability during rapid transitions on the Shinkansen. Poorly configured eSIMs drop the signal entirely during high-speed cell handoffs, forcing you to constantly toggle airplane mode to reconnect manually.

Features & Usability

Hotspot tethering and pre-activation ensure a seamless transition upon landing. If a travel eSIM blocks data sharing, you cannot support other devices, while lacking pre-activation forces a frustrating hunt for unreliable airport Wi-Fi.

Customer Support

Human technical assistance is critical for troubleshooting activation issues abroad. When QR codes or APN settings fail, automated bots cannot resolve the conflict. Real-time human support ensures technical hurdles do not halt your itinerary.

Who Might Choose a Different Japan Tourist eSIM Option

While an eSIM is the most convenient choice for most, certain scenarios may require the traditional Japan SIM cards or alternative connectivity methods.

  • Long-Term Residents: Those staying in Japan for more than 90 days or on a working holiday visa may require a local Japanese phone number (+81) for administrative tasks, which most travel eSIMs do not provide.
  • Older Hardware Users: Travelers using devices manufactured before 2018 (such as the iPhone 8 or older Samsung models) will not have the necessary internal hardware to support an eSIM and must use a physical SIM card.
  • Mainland China/HK Devices: Some iPhone models sold in mainland China, Hong Kong, or Macau are designed with two physical SIM slots and lack eSIM functionality entirely.

These trade-offs mainly affect longer-stay or working travelers, while most short-term tourists benefit more from the convenience of digital eSIMs.

You should install your Japan eSIM profile right before your departure while connected to home Wi-Fi. Turn on data roaming only after you land. Your plan’s official validity period begins once the profile connects to a local network, preventing any wasted data days before your vacation starts.
